**Vendor note: Inkmill markdown pipeline**

Rendering for Parchway docs is outsourced to Inkmill under an annual contract, renewing each March. They handle sanitization and PDF export; we own the upload queue. SLA: 4-hour response on rendering failures. Escalate only after two failed retries. Their support desk is reachable at the address below.

billing contact of hahaf-baguf = zorael.tammir.jorius@sivrelhq.internal

// Circuit breaker wrapping calls to the Verrow pricing API.
// Opens after 5 consecutive failures, half-opens after 30s,
// and falls back to the Lanquist cache while open. Contractors:
// don't tune these thresholds without sign-off from the Harrowgate
// platform team, since downstream dashboards assume them. The
// client below authenticates to the internal Verrow proxy with
// the key that follows.

gateway credential: kto23_LX9A4ys6i4nzHtpOLNLodKK

**Q: We're mid-refactor on the old Grainworks ORM — what if something breaks on-call?**

Don't panic. The legacy mappers in Tillage are still wired up behind a feature flag, so flip `use_legacy_orm` and restart. If the admin console locks you out during the rollback, use the recovery phrase below to regain access.

unlock words, yawig-kagef: gordor-holvan-ulaael-pramir-ulaiel-tamdor

Subject: Handover — FareLab pricing experiment

Hey, quick handover before I log off. The FareLab A/B test on dynamic ticket pricing is mid-flight; treatment arm got bumped to 20% this afternoon. Watch the revenue-per-session dashboard — if it dips more than 5%, kill the flag, don't debate it. The rollback PR is already approved and waiting. Any questions on the experiment config, email the pricing experiments group.

billing contact of hahig-yajop = fraael_fraox@nelvrocorp.internal

# Support note: Gristmill GraphQL client setup.
# This client batches ticket lookups through a dataloader to fix the
# N+1 pattern that previously fired one query per attachment row.
# Do not disable batching when reproducing customer issues — it will
# overload the Quarrylight backend. The client authenticates to the
# internal Loomgate service with the key on the next line.

gateway credential: kto3_qfe